<center><h1>Module <a href="type_Xdr.html">Xdr</a></h1></center>
<br>
<pre><span class="keyword">module</span> Xdr: <code class="code">sig</code> <a href="Xdr.html">..</a> <code class="code">end</code></pre>External Data Representation<br>
<hr width="100%">
<br>
This module supports the "external data representation", or XDR
for short. XDR is a means to pack structured values as strings and
it serves to transport such values across character streams even
between computers with different architectures.
<p>
XDR values must be formed according to an XDR type. Such types are
usually written in a notation that is close to the C notation of
structured types. There are some important details where XDR is
better than C:<ul>
<li>direct support for strings</li>
<li>arrays may have fixed or variable length</li>
<li>unions must have a discriminator</li>
<li>no pointers. The notation <code class="code">*t</code> is allowed, but means something
different, namely "t option" in O'Caml notation.</li>
<li>recursive types are possible and behave like recursive types in
O'Caml. For example,
<pre><code class="code"> struct *list {
int value;
next list;
}
</code></pre>
is a list of integer values and equivalent to
<pre><code class="code"> type intlist = intlist_el option
and intlist_el = { value : int; next : intlist }
</code></pre></li>
</ul>
See RFC 1014 for details about XDR.
<p>
This module defines:<ul>
<li>XDR types</li>
<li>XDR type terms</li>
<li>XDR type systems</li>
<li>XDR type term systems</li>
</ul>
In "type terms" you can see the components from which the type has been
formed, while a "type" is an opaque representation that has been checked
and for that some preprocessing has been done.
<p>
A "type system" is a collection of several types that have names and that
can refer to previously defined types (i.e. a sequence of "typedef"s).
As with simple types, there is an extensive and an opaque representation.
<p>
A typical way of using this module is to define an "XDR type term system"
by simply writing an O'Caml expression. After that, this system is validated
and you get the "type system". From now on, you can refer to the types
defined in the system by name and get the corresponding "XDR types".
Once you have an XDR type you can use it to pack or unpack an XDR value.<br>

Terms that describe possible XDR types:
<p>
<ul>
<li><code class="code">X_int</code>: integer (32 bit)</li>
<li><code class="code">X_uint</code>: unsigned integer</li>
<li><code class="code">X_hyper</code>: hyper (64 bit signed integer)</li>
<li><code class="code">X_uhyper</code>: unsigned hyper</li>
<li><code class="code">X_enum [x1,i1; ...]</code>: <code class="code">enum { x1 = i1, ... }</code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_float</code>: float (32 bit fp number)</li>
<li><code class="code">X_double</code>: double (64 bit fp number)</li>
<li><code class="code">X_opaque_fixed n</code>: <code class="code">opaque[n]</code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_opaque n</code>: <code class="code">opaque<n></code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_string n</code>: <code class="code">string<n></code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_array_fixed (t,n)</code>: <code class="code">t[n]</code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_array (t,n)</code>: <code class="code">t<n></code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_struct [x1,t1;...]</code>: <code class="code">struct { t1 x1; ...}</code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_union_over_int
([n1,t1;...], None)</code>: <code class="code">union switch(int) {case n1: t1; ...}</code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_union_over_int
([n1,t1;...], Some t)</code>: <code class="code">union switch(int) {case n1: t1; ...; default t}</code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_union_over_uint
([n1,t1;...], None)</code>: <code class="code">union switch(unsigned int) {case n1: t1; ...}</code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_union_over_uint
([n1,t1;...], Some t)</code>: <code class="code">union switch(unsigned int)
{case n1: t1; ...; default t}</code></li>
<li><code class="code">X_union_over_enum
(e, [n1,t1;...], None)</code>: <code class="code">union switch(e) {case n1:t1; ...}</code>
where e is an enumeration type</li>
<li><code class="code">X_union_over_enum
(e, [n1,t1;...], Some t)</code>: <code class="code">union switch(e) {case n1:t1; ...; default t}</code>
where e is an enumeration type</li>
<li><code class="code">X_void</code>: void</li>
</ul>
The <code class="code">X_type</code> constructor is only useful for types interpreted relative to
a type system. Then it refers to a named type in this system.
<p>
The <code class="code">X_param</code> constructor includes a reference to an arbitrary type
which must only be given while packing or unpacking values.
(A "lazy" type reference.)
<p>
Example how to define a recursive type:
<p>
<code class="code">X_rec ("a", X_array ( X_struct ["value", X_int; "next", X_refer "a"], 1))</code><br>

Is the value properly formed with respect to this type? The third
argument of this function is a list of parameter instances. Note that
all parameters must be instantiated to compare a value with a type
and that the parameters instances are not allowed to have parameters
themselves.<br>
<pre><span class="keyword">val</span> <a name="VALvalue_matches_type"></a>value_matches_type : <code class="type"><a href="Xdr.html#TYPExdr_value">xdr_value</a> -> <a href="Xdr.html#TYPExdr_type">xdr_type</a> -> (string * <a href="Xdr.html#TYPExdr_type">xdr_type</a>) list -> bool</code></pre><br>
<code class="code">pack_xdr_value v t p print</code>: Serialize v into a string conforming to
the XDR standard where v matches t. In p the parameter instances are
given. All parameters must be given, the parameters must not contain
parameters themselves. The fourth argument, print, is a function
which is evaluated for the pieces of the resultant string. You can use
pack_xdr_value_as_string to get the whole string at once.
<p>
<code class="code">unpack_xdr_value s t p</code>: Unserialize a string to a value
matching t. If this operation fails you get an Xdr_format
exception explaining what the reason for the failure is.
Mostly the cause for failures is that t isn't the type
of the value.
Note that there are some implementation restrictions limiting
the number of elements in array, strings and opaque fields.
If you get such an error this normally still means that
the value is not of the expected type, because these limits
have no practical meaning (they are still higher than the
usable address space).<br>
